Dr. Robert Koller (Forschungszentrum Jülich, Institute of Bio- and Geosciences, Plant Sciences) guides in dialogue with Franziska Nori through the exhibition The Intelligence of Plants.

The Frankfurter Kunstverein has invited natural scientists and artists to visually transfer their work and knowledge into the exhibition spaces. The collaboration resulted from the cooperation with Prof. Dr. Ulrich Schurr, Director of the Institute of Bio- and Geosciences: Plant Sciences and the scientists Dr. Robert Koller and Dr. Andreas Müller. Forschungszentrum Jülich is part of the Helmholtz Association (HGF) and, with over 6,500 employees, is one of the largest research centres in Germany.

In the exhibition The Intelligence of Plants the Forschungszentrum Jülich presents scientific exhibits which deal with topics such as plants as the basis for food and renewable raw materials for energy and building material. They use visualising key technologies for the study of living plants (=phenotyping) and develope innovative concepts of bioeconomy.
